More water issues in the Surlingham Area

Low water pressure is present throughout area. Anglia Water reports main damage at Kirby Bedon and Sallow Lane. Also at foot of Pratt’s Hill. Anglia Water have been asked to explain why they cannot fix it permanently and any statement … Continue reading

Seeking owner of black and white male cat found on The Street on Friday night

Large black and white male cat, with white paws (more white on back paws), found injured last night, 2nd Feb, near 15 The Street. He has been neutered but not chipped. If you are missing your cat or you know … Continue reading

Kirby Road – road closure

According to roadworks.org, Kirby Road will be closed until Sunday 28th January 2018.  This information was available at 09:48 and promulgated on the site at 15:12 on the 25th January.  These works are to repair a burst water main and … Continue reading

St Mary’s Bells

Following the quinquennial inspection of St Mary’s, the architect responsible has expressed concern about the safety of the tower due to apparent cracking of the external masonry and deterioration in the internal beams. She has said that we must not … Continue reading
